Old Milestone in Haile

    "Carved stone post by the UC road, in parish of HAILE (COPELAND District), Beck Brow, Haile village, T-junction against wall, on East side of road. Egremont stone, erected by the Egremont to Salthouse turnpike trust in the 19th century. Inscription reads:- : To / Ennerdale / Bridge / 2 Miles : : To / Egremont / (?) Miles : Grade II Listed. List Entry Number: 1336075 https://historicengland.org.uk/listing/the-list/list-entry/1336075 Milestone Society National ID: CU_CBEG." Photo by CF Smith, 2010.
